DataFrame.head([n]) 返回前n行数据 DataFrame.at 快速标签常量访问器 DataFrame.iat 快速整型常量访问器 DataFrame.loc 标签定位 DataFrame.iloc 整型定位 DataFrame.insert(loc, column, value[, …]) 在特殊地点插入行 DataFrame.iter() Iterate over infor axis ...
Replace:如DataFrame.replace({'B':'E','C':'F'})表示将表中的B替换为E,C替换为F。 Pandas数据运算 算术运算:Pandas的数据对象在进行算术运算时,如果有相同索引则进行算术运算,如果没有则会进行数据对齐,但会引入缺失值。 a = np.arange(6).reshape(2,3) b = np.arange(4).reshape(2,2) df1 = ...
1、创建目标文件夹 # mkdir -p /data/mysql # chown -R mysql.mysql /data/mysql/ 2、迁移命令 ...
df.rename(columns=lambda x:x.replace('yhhx_result.',''), inplace=True) #统一去掉列名的某个前缀 groupby 分组后进行筛选,并形成新的df df_group_small = pd.DataFrame(columns=df.columns) df_group_large = pd.DataFrame(columns=df.columns) for k in set(group.keys): if len(group.get_group...
[88, np.nan, 95,np.nan]} df = pd.DataFrame(data) nan_replaced = df.replace(np....
pandas DataFrame的一些操作 最近做数据预处理遇到了一些小问题,记录一下。 1.数据的读取和存储 一般读取数据使用pandas里的read_csv pd.read_csv(path, sep=',', header=None, nrows=n) 另外通用的读取为: with open(filename, 'r', encoding='utf-8') as fr: #这里注意如果是中文的文件可能需要改...
pandas的dataframe结构体使用fillna的过程中出现错误 有如下的warning: SettingWithCopyWarning: A value is trying to be set on a copy of a slice from a DataFrame 我的使用类似于以下这个例子: import pandas as pd import numpy as np df = pd.DataFrame({'woniu':[-np.inf,2,3,np.nan], 'che':...
Pandas DataFrame - replace() function: The replace() function is used to replace values given in to_replace with value.
df = pd.DataFrame(d) df.replace('white', np.nan) 输出仍然是: color second_color value 0 white white 1 1 blue black 2 2 orange blue 3 这个问题通常使用inplace=True来解决,但也有一些注意事项。另请参阅了解 pandas 中的 inplace=True。
Examples Scalar to_replace and value In [1]: import numpy as np import pandas as pd In [2]: s = pd.Series([0, 2, 3, 4, 5]) s.replace(0, 6) Out[2]: 0 6 1 2 2 3 3 4 4 5 dtype: int64 In [3]: df = pd.DataFrame({'P': [0, 2, 3, 4, 5], 'Q': [6, 7...